Sure, be glad to.

Longer burning hotter spark is more fuel efficient, burns the fuel more completely.
This gives more power, smoother idle, and cleaner exhaust, as well as better hot and cold starts.

The "less complicated" statement is the fact that there is WAY less wires to route, no ballast needed, and no 10 feet of module wire (4 or 5 wire module like the stock unit.)

I realize a lot of people have an issue with using a GM ignition, but they are known for thier power, reliability and ease of getting replacement parts if they are needed.
